Requirements for a Minor in Education
Code | Title | Hours |
---|---|---|
Requirements | ||
EDUC 220 | Profession of Teaching | 3 |
EDUC 221 | Fieldwork in Profession of Teaching | 1 |
EDUC 230 | Content Area Literacy | 3 |
EDUC 233 | Survey of Exceptional Children | 3 |
EDUC 300 | Education Practicum | 1 |
EDUC 321 | Educational Psychology | 3 |
EDUC 330 | Assessment in Education | 3 |
EDUC 335 | Curriculum and Educational Technology | 3 |
EDUC 340 | Diversity in Education | 3 |
EDUC 355 | Secondary, Arts, and Language Education Methods | 3 |
EDUC 416 | Senior Seminar for Secondary, Arts, and Language Student Teachers | 3 |
EDUC 425 | Observation (for student teaching) | 3 |
EDUC 426 | Student Teaching | 6 |
Total Hours | 38 |
Only students majoring in Elementary Education or Exceptional Education may minor in Education. The Education minor only results in eligibility for licensure when completed in conjunction with the Elementary Education or Exceptional Education major and a major in the content area - Biology, Chemistry, Physics, Spanish, Math, History, English, Music [Choral or Instrumental], or Classics (Latin). Additional courses may be required for licensing in the endorsement areas.
